Publishers bid to stop use of 'Metro' title by Independent

The publishers of a new giveaway newspaper will not go ahead with the launch unless they get an injunction preventing Independent News and Media from using the word ``metro'' in the title of its planned rival freesheet, the High Court was told today.

The publishers of the new ``Metro'' freesheet are seeking an interim injunction to prevent the use of the word ``metro'' in the title of a rival freesheet planned by Independent News and Media. The court was told on Monday that the new ``Metro'' is to be launched this week.
